The Winnetka Park District, you know, is quite a significant part of life for folks in northern Cook County. It stretches across a good bit of land, about 4.8 square miles, right there next to the beautiful shores of Lake Michigan. It's also, like, not too far from the city buzz, sitting around 17 miles north of downtown Chicago, which is pretty convenient for many.
This organization, the Winnetka Park District, actually stands as one of five different groups that help run things for the people living in Winnetka. These groups are all about making sure the community has what it needs, and the Winnetka Park District plays its own special part in that bigger picture, focusing on places for recreation and enjoying the outdoors. It’s, in a way, a key piece of the local fabric, providing services and spaces for everyone.
When you consider all the spots the Winnetka Park District looks after, it's quite a lot, honestly. We're talking about nearly five square miles of various places for people to enjoy. This includes a pretty impressive collection of 26 different parks, which is quite something, don't you think? Then there are five distinct beach areas, a place for launching boats into the water, and also a couple of golf courses where you can hit some balls. Where Can You Find the Winnetka Park District?
If you're looking to get in touch with the Winnetka Park District or visit their main spot, it's actually pretty straightforward. Their administrative and recreation office is located at 540 Hibbard Road in Winnetka, Illinois, with the zip code 60093. Listening to the Community- Winnetka Park District's Plan
To help guide what they do in the years to come, the Winnetka Park District actually finished a community survey in 2024. This survey was a really important step in putting together their big, overall plan for the future. By asking people what they thought, the survey is helping the district figure out what things should be worked on first when it comes to making improvements to their parks and other spots.
